Stat Priority for Outlaw Rogue in PvP
The stat priority for Outlaw Rogue in PvP is as follows:
- Agility
- Versatility
- Haste
- Critical Strike
- Mastery
Agility is the best stat in all situations. Versatility is the strongest
secondary stat because it increases your damage and reduces the damage you take.
Haste is the second most important stat because
Adrenaline Rush reduces
your global cooldown from 1s down to 0.8s based on your Haste.
Reaching 0.8s value is to achieve 25% Haste.
Critical Strike is the third best stat because, as Outlaw, your main
ability,
Between the Eyes, deals bonus critical damage and increases
your Critical Strike chance with all abilities.

Note: It is essential to be wearing 2 PvP trinkets. This will give you a Stamina and stat boost that will increase your survivability.
Outlaw Rogue Tier Sets
It is important to note that ALL tier sets are nerfed to 33% effectiveness in PvP. Although this nerf is significant, some tier sets are still important to acquire to maximize your chances to win. For Outlaw Rogues, this is your tier set:
- 2-set:
Blade Rush's damage is increased by 30% and its damage
to your primary target is increased by an additional 15%. - 4-set:
Blade Rush's cooldown is reduced by 6 seconds and
it increases your damage dealt by 5% for 8 seconds.
In general, it is recommended to get both 2-set, but you should not get 4-set for Outlaw Rogues
Outlaw Rogue Embellishments
Embellishments are bonuses that can be put on crafted gear. These effects can have a drastic impact on the game. You are only allowed to have two Embellishments equipped at the same time. Here are the recommended Embellishments for Outlaw Rogue:
Arcanoweave Lining. This Embellishment gives your spells and
abilities a chance to empower you and an ally. This will increase you and
your teammate's primary stat. Overall, this is will give you and your team
the highest damage output.

For gems, you should primarily be using
Enduring Heliotrope for the
meta slot, and filling all other gem slots with
Flawless Quick Lapis.
